log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

Wyznaczanie poziomu THD we wzmacniaczu mocy w PSpice - jak to zrobić?

mosfet 04 Gru 2005 20:20 4184 7
REKLAMA
  • #1 2053801
    mosfet
    Poziom 25  
    Posty: 917
    Pomógł: 5
    Ocena: 27
    Mam zaprojektowany w PSpice wzmacniacz mocy. Jak wyznaczyć poziom zniekształceń?
  • REKLAMA
  • Pomocny post
    #2 2053982
    kilork
    Poziom 17  
    Posty: 204
    Pomógł: 20
    Ocena: 10
    Witam! Wg moich notatek odczytywało się ten parametr po analizie:

    Analysis/Simulate
    po zadeklerowaniu parametrów analizy parametr THD (Total Harmonic Distortion) odczytuje się na dole tabeli w pliku wyjściowym: nazwa.out.
    Jeśli potrzeba to proszę jeszcze dopiszę , powodzenia.
  • REKLAMA
  • #3 2054612
    mosfet
    Poziom 25  
    Posty: 917
    Pomógł: 5
    Ocena: 27
    tak :) jest tam obliczone THD, tylko ze jakieś bzdury wychodza. Sygnał "na oko" ładna sinusida nie gorzej niż 1% a analiza THD pisze 7E+01 percent czyli jakby 70% THD ! coś tu nie gra :(
  • #4 2054997
    kilork
    Poziom 17  
    Posty: 204
    Pomógł: 20
    Ocena: 10
    Witam! Może należy inaczej zadeklarować parametry analizy,
    od której do której harmonicznej są brane obliczenia (
    Number of harmonics , Print step , Final Time Center Frequency)
    w analizie czasowej Transient Analysis oraz czy we właściwej zmiennej wyjściowej Output Vars. Powodzenia
  • REKLAMA
  • #5 2055034
    vibrasphere
    Poziom 15  
    Posty: 134
    Pomógł: 11
    Ocena: 1
    E... ludzie to ma być fourier
    np:
    .FOUR 1k V(3)
    gdzie 1k - czestotliwość
  • REKLAMA
  • #6 2232625
    Cichy_człowiek
    Poziom 11  
    Posty: 18
    Hej jak jeszcze jesteś zainteresowany THD to daj znać. Napiszę ci co i jak.
  • #7 3241468
    tomuch
    Poziom 11  
    Posty: 73
    Pomógł: 1
    Ocena: 1
    witam, a jeżeli nie ma zarówno w pliku *.out, jak i *.out.*? Orcad 9.2. Co zrobic, gdzie szukać?

    Dodano po 5 [minuty]:

    wygenerowalo takie pliki
    Załączniki:
    • Kopia laborka.out.txt (17.03 KB) Musisz być zalogowany, aby pobrać ten załącznik.
    • Kopia laborka.out.1.txt (17.03 KB) Musisz być zalogowany, aby pobrać ten załącznik.
  • #8 6049292
    johnymo
    Poziom 10  
    Posty: 9
    A gdy trzeba obliczyć poziom THD w całym zakresie np dla generatora,1Hz-20kHz, jak wtedy postępujemy? Na piechote zmieniamy wartości elementow RC, odczytujemy czestotliwość i podajemy ją do analizy harmonicznych, czy może wystarczy podać częstotliwość środkowa wyłącznie raz? A ile najlepiej podać harmonicznych do analizy?

Podsumowanie tematu

✨ Dyskusja dotyczy wyznaczania poziomu zniekształceń harmonicznych (THD) we wzmacniaczu mocy zaprojektowanym w PSpice. Wskazano, że THD można odczytać po przeprowadzeniu analizy harmonicznej (Fourier) w PSpice, np. za pomocą polecenia .FOUR z określeniem częstotliwości i zmiennej wyjściowej. Parametr THD pojawia się w pliku wynikowym *.out, jednak mogą wystąpić problemy z nieprawidłowymi wartościami, co może wynikać z błędnej deklaracji parametrów analizy, takich jak liczba harmonicznych, krok drukowania czy czas analizy. Zaleca się poprawne ustawienie zakresu analizy harmonicznej oraz wybór odpowiedniej zmiennej wyjściowej. W przypadku analizy w szerokim zakresie częstotliwości (np. 1 Hz–20 kHz) pojawia się pytanie o konieczność ręcznej zmiany elementów i częstotliwości lub użycie częstotliwości środkowej oraz liczby harmonicznych do analizy. Wskazano, że analiza THD wymaga zastosowania transformacji Fouriera i odpowiedniej konfiguracji symulacji transient oraz harmonicznych w PSpice.
Wygenerowane przez model językowy.
REKLAMA